A Natural Progression: From Mortgage to Title and Beyond

Helen Johnson’s entry into the real estate title business began approximately two decades ago, stemming from a pivotal career shift. Having honed her skills and understanding of the financial landscape in the mortgage sector, she was approached by a headhunter with an intriguing proposition. “I was working in mortgages when I received a call asking if I was ready for a new challenge in the title business,” Johnson recalls. “I seized the opportunity, and that’s truly when all the excitement and fulfilling work in real estate began for me. It was a leap of faith that paid off immensely, opening doors to a specialized field where I could truly make a difference.”

The title industry, often unseen by the casual observer, is the backbone of every real estate transaction, ensuring clear ownership and peace of mind for buyers and sellers alike. Helen quickly immersed herself, recognizing the critical role of diligent research and meticulous execution in securing property rights. Her natural aptitude for understanding complex processes and her dedication to client satisfaction laid the groundwork for a distinguished career.

Following in her mother’s footsteps, Tiffany Johnson Beecham joined the title company after graduating college in 2007. Growing up surrounded by the vibrant world of real estate professionals, from agents to lenders, it felt like an incredibly natural fit for Tiffany to enter the industry. “I practically grew up at open houses and industry events with my mom,” Beecham explains. “The intricacies of property transactions and the vital role of ensuring a smooth closing always fascinated me. It felt less like a career choice and more like a calling.”

The mother-daughter team now thrives together at Providence Title’s Preston Center location, a hub of activity where their combined expertise creates a seamless experience for clients. Helen leads in business development, leveraging her extensive network and deep industry knowledge to forge new relationships and grow the company’s presence. Tiffany, on the other hand, excels as an escrow officer, a role that perfectly suits her compassionate nature and meticulous attention to detail.

Helen vividly remembers the joy when Tiffany transitioned into her current role: “I was so excited when Tiffany was ready to become an escrow officer because I knew her genuine love for working with people would shine through. She possesses a remarkable empathy and a deep sense of responsibility, qualities that are absolutely essential in this position. I could trust her implicitly to handle every transaction with the utmost care and precision. One of Tiffany’s many strengths is her ability to make everyone involved feel at ease and happy. She makes it her top priority to ensure every client has a stress-free experience and truly enjoys the closing process, turning what can often be a daunting step into a celebratory one.”
